Position Summary

We have an exciting opportunity to join our team as a Clinical Supply Chain Coordinator.

Job Responsibilities
  • Coordinates with Nursing Leadership the re-ordering, re-stocking, and reconciliation of discrepancies of the supplies/implants based upon established par levels and consignment agreement.
  • Create requisitions for implant use in operating/procedural rooms:
    • Bill Only POs
    • Consignment Orders
    • Manual/Rush requisitions
    • Special Requests Orders
    • No Charge POs (trials/consignments)
  • Verifies and validates vendor consignment replenishment requests based upon on-hand inventory as well as Operating Room usage.
  • Responsible for creating Patient Supply Requests for all newly added implants (consigned & non-consigned) in accordance with participating in the Inventory Control Board.
  • Maintains invoices, packing slips, and ensures receipts on all purchase orders associated with consignment products.
  • Establishes vendor appointments based on upcoming schedule and verification of attendance (in accordance with Nursing) within Vendormate.
  • Performs all inventory functions along with vendor sales rep, i.e. monthly/quarterly inventory, reconciliations, item updates, recalls, backorders, etc.
  • Identifies and communicates any backorders, recalls, or discontinued items with Nursing Leadership and CSCM Assistant Manager and coordinates necessary substitutes. Provides analytical reports to the CSCM Associate Director and Business Manager upon request.
  • Demonstrates the ability to maximize resources and is skillful in adjusting resources according to the workload and volume.
  • Demonstrates knowledge in generating and interpreting statistical, productivity, and quality performance reports and utilizes the data to improve the departments performance.
  • Accurately and consistently follows documentation guidelines in all phases of the process as required by the department and regulatory agencies.
  • Demonstrates comprehensive knowledge and technical expertise in inventory control principles.
  • Demonstrates ability and skills to monitor, audit and enhance the quality of the process and products manufactured or rendered to customers by the department.
  • Demonstrates ability to utilize management skills in good judgment and decision making, time management and meeting deadlines and demonstrates a high level of initiative.
  • Maintains continued education in the field of Materials Management operations and equipment through education, literature, and seminars. Provides instructions and in-services in new products, procedures and equipment in a manner that will identify and prevent resource loss and maintain safety.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
Minimum Qualifications
  • To qualify you must have a Bachelor's Degree or the equivalent experience in a Healthcare related field and/or a combination of similar education and experience.
  • 1 year of Operating Room/Supply Chain/Sterile Processing experience.
  • Knowledge of Clinical Supply/Materials Management general operations.
  • Strong skills related to the management of inventory control with a minimum 3 years of responsible progressive work experiences in supply distribution.
  • Knowledge of specific health care products.
  • Current membership and active participation in a relevant professional organization.
  • Must possess basic computer literacy and proficiency in Microsoft Office applications required.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Certification in Materials Resources (CMRP).
  • Experience in computerized inventory control with an emphasis on medical/surgical supplies.
  • 1-2 years of EPIC/patient scheduling experience. (Peoplesoft 9+ preferred).
